True-
Here in Northern DE - we've had TCM HD for quite some time.

UP HD used to be GMC (Gospel Music Channel) HD

DXD HD has been here since the June 2012 adds (last time we got a new HD channel)

As far as your duplicate HD question - WOW - they took away our duplicates here in the 200's over a year ago - surprised they're being so lazy in your area. However - the channel is just mirrored into 2 different channel ID's - they are not using "double the bandwidth" so to speak.

For instance, they could put CNN HD on 24 different channel #'s, but it'd only be the one QAM being used.
